/* SM Jailbreak Thanos round * * Copyright (C) 2019 Francisco 'Franc1sco' García * * This program is free software: you can redistribute it and/or modify it * under the terms of the GNU General Public License as published by the Free * Software Foundation, either version 3 of the License, or (at your option) * any later version. * * This program is distributed in the hope that it will be useful, but WITHOUT * ANY WARRANTY; without even the implied warranty of MERCHANTABILITY or FITNESS * FOR A PARTICULAR PURPOSE. See the GNU General Public License for more details. * * You should have received a copy of the GNU General Public License along with * this program. If not, see http://www.gnu.org/licenses/. */ #include <sourcemod> #include <sdktools> #include <sdkhooks> #include <cstrike> #include <warden> #include <myjbwarden> #include <myjailbreak> #include <myweapons> #include <smartjaildoors> int usuarios; #define SOLID_NONE 0 #define FSOLID_NOT_SOLID 0x0004 new Float:MinNadeHull[3] = {-2.5, -2.5, -2.5}; new Float:MaxNadeHull[3] = {2.5, 2.5, 2.5}; new Float:SpinVel[3] = {0.0, 0.0, 200.0}; new Float:SmokeOrigin[3] = {-30.0,0.0,0.0}; new Float:SmokeAngle[3] = {0.0,-180.0,0.0}; #define MINUTES 30 bool soccer; int g_iTime; bool pending; #define DATA "1.0" int thanos; int NadeDamage = 1000; int NadeRadius = 350; float NadeSpeed = 900.0; new g_iToolsVelocity; public Plugin myinfo = { name = "SM Jailbreak Thanos round", author = "Franc1sco franug", description = "", version = DATA, url = "http://steamcommunity.com/id/franug" }; public OnPluginStart() { g_iToolsVelocity = FindSendPropInfo("CBasePlayer", "m_vecVelocity[0]"); HookEvent("round_prestart", Event_RoundStart); HookEvent("round_start", Event_RoundStartFix); HookEvent("round_end", Event_End); HookEvent("player_spawn", PlayerSpawn); HookEvent("player_jump", Event_OnPlayerJump); HookEvent("player_jump", Event_OnPlayerJumpPre, EventHookMode_Pre); RegAdminCmd("sm_setthanos", Command_Set, ADMFLAG_ROOT); RegAdminCmd("sm_thanos", Command_Soccer, ADMFLAG_CUSTOM1); RegAdminCmd("sm_vengadores", Command_Soccer, ADMFLAG_CUSTOM1); for (new i = 1; i <= MaxClients; i++) if (IsClientInGame(i)) OnClientPutInServer(i); } public Action:Command_Set(client, args) { if(soccer) { ReplyToCommand(client, "Thanos round in progress already."); return Plugin_Handled; } if(args < 1) // Not enough parameters { ReplyToCommand(client, "[SM] use: smsetthanos <#userid|name>"); return Plugin_Handled; } decl String:arg[30]; GetCmdArg(1, arg, sizeof(arg)); new target; if((target = FindTarget(client, arg, false, false)) == -1) { ReplyToCommand(client, "No found"); thanos = 0; return Plugin_Handled; // Target not found... } ReplyToCommand(client, "%N will be the next Thanos", target); thanos = target; return Plugin_Handled; } public OnMapStart() { AddFileToDownloadsTable("models/player/custom_player/kaesar2018/thanos/thanos.dx90.vtx"); AddFileToDownloadsTable("models/player/custom_player/kaesar2018/thanos/thanos.mdl"); AddFileToDownloadsTable("models/player/custom_player/kaesar2018/thanos/thanos.phy"); AddFileToDownloadsTable("models/player/custom_player/kaesar2018/thanos/thanos.vvd"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_body_d.vmt"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_body_d.vtf"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_body_n.vtf"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_gauntlet_d.vmt"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_gauntlet_d.vtf"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_gauntlet_n.vtf"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_head_d.vmt"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_head_d.vtf"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_head_n.vtf"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_helmet_d.vmt"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_helmet_d.vtf"); AddFileToDownloadsTable("materials/models/player/kaesar2018/thanos/t_m_lrg_jim_helmet_n.vtf"); PrecacheModel("models/player/custom_player/kaesar2018/thanos/thanos.mdl"); AddFileToDownloadsTable("sound/music/franug_rocket1.mp3"); AddFileToDownloadsTable("materials/models/weapons/w_missile/missile side.vmt"); AddFileToDownloadsTable("models/weapons/W_missile_closed.dx80.vtx"); AddFileToDownloadsTable("models/weapons/W_missile_closed.dx90.vtx"); AddFileToDownloadsTable("models/weapons/W_missile_closed.mdl"); AddFileToDownloadsTable("models/weapons/W_missile_closed.phy"); AddFileToDownloadsTable("models/weapons/W_missile_closed.sw.vtx"); AddFileToDownloadsTable("models/weapons/W_missile_closed.vvd"); PrecacheModel("models/weapons/w_missile_closed.mdl"); PrecacheSound("music/franug_rocket1.mp3"); PrecacheSound("weapons/hegrenade/explode5.wav"); } public OnPluginEnd() { if (!soccer && !pending)return; Terminar(); } public Action Command_Soccer(int client, int args) { DoVoteMenu(client); return Plugin_Handled; } void DoVoteMenu(int client) { if (IsVoteInProgress()) { PrintToChat(client, " \x03Already a vote in progress, wait for the end."); return; } if (MyJailbreak_IsEventDayPlanned()) { PrintToChat(client, " \x03You cant use this if already a thanos day planned."); return; } if (MyJailbreak_IsEventDayRunning()) { PrintToChat(client, " \x03You cant use this command when already a special day running."); return; } if (!HasPermission(client, "z") && GetTime() < (g_iTime+(MINUTES*60))) { PrintToChat(client, " \x03You cant use this, wait %i seconds more.", (g_iTime+(MINUTES*60)) - GetTime()); return; } g_iTime = GetTime(); Menu menu = new Menu(Handle_VoteMenu); menu.SetTitle("Start a Thanos day in the next round?"); menu.AddItem("yes", "Yes"); menu.AddItem("no", "No"); menu.DisplayVoteToAll(20); } public int Handle_VoteMenu(Menu menu, MenuAction action, int param1,int param2) { if (action == MenuAction_End) { /* This is called after VoteEnd */ delete menu; } else if (action == MenuAction_VoteEnd) { /* 0=yes, 1=no */ if (param1 == 0) { pending = true; ServerCommand("sm_ratio_enable 0"); ServerCommand("sm_ctbans_enable 0"); MyJailbreak_SetEventDayName("Thanos"); MyJailbreak_SetEventDayPlanned(true); PrintCenterTextAll("THANOS DAY START IN THE NEXT ROUND!"); PrintToChatAll(" \x03THANOS DAY START IN THE NEXT ROUND!"); } else { PrintToChatAll(" \x03The thanos vote was negative."); } } } public Action:PlayerSpawn(Handle:event, const String:name[], bool:dontBroadcast) { if (!soccer)return; int client = GetClientOfUserId(GetEventInt(event, "userid")); CreateTimer(3.0, Timer_Thanos, GetClientUserId(client)); } public Action Timer_Thanos(Handle timer, int id) { int client = GetClientOfUserId(id); if (!client || !IsClientInGame(client))return; if (thanos != client) { if(GetClientTeam(client) == CS_TEAM_CT) { ChangeClientTeam(client, CS_TEAM_T); CS_RespawnPlayer(client); } return; } SetEntityModel(thanos, "models/player/custom_player/kaesar2018/thanos/thanos.mdl"); SetEntityGravity(thanos, 0.3); SetEntProp(thanos, Prop_Data, "m_iHealth", usuarios * 1000); GivePlayerItem(thanos, "weapon_hegrenade"); SJD_OpenDoors(); PrintCenterTextAll("Thanos are there!"); } Empezar() { if(thanos == 0 || !IsClientInGame(thanos) || GetClientTeam(thanos) < 2) thanos = GetRandomPlayer(); if (!thanos) { Terminar(); return; } usuarios = 0; for (int i = 1; i <= MaxClients; i++) { if (!IsClientInGame(i) || GetClientTeam(i) < 2) continue; usuarios++; if(i != thanos && GetClientTeam(i) == CS_TEAM_CT) { CS_SwitchTeam(i, CS_TEAM_T); //CS_RespawnPlayer(i); } else if(i == thanos && GetClientTeam(thanos) == CS_TEAM_T) { CS_SwitchTeam(i, CS_TEAM_CT); } } soccer = true; if(warden_exist()) { warden_removed(warden_get()); } SetCvar("sm_hosties_lr", 0); SetCvar("sm_menu_enable", 0); SetCvar("mp_friendlyfire", 0); MyWeapons_AllowTeam(CS_TEAM_T, true); MyWeapons_AllowTeam(CS_TEAM_CT, false); warden_enable(false); } Terminar() { thanos = 0; soccer = false; MyJailbreak_SetEventDayRunning(false, 0); MyJailbreak_SetEventDayName("none"); SetCvar("sm_hosties_lr", 1); SetCvar("sm_menu_enable", 1); ServerCommand("sm_ratio_enable 1"); ServerCommand("sm_ctbans_enable 1"); MyWeapons_AllowTeam(CS_TEAM_T, false); MyWeapons_AllowTeam(CS_TEAM_CT, true); warden_enable(true); } public Action Event_RoundStart(Event event, const char[] szName, bool bDontBroadcast) { if (!pending && !soccer)return; Empezar(); MyJailbreak_SetEventDayPlanned(false); MyJailbreak_SetEventDayRunning(true, 0); pending = false; ServerCommand("sm_ratio_enable 1"); } public Action Event_RoundStartFix(Event event, const char[] szName, bool bDontBroadcast) { if (!soccer)return; SetCvar("mp_friendlyfire", 0); } public Action Event_End(Event event, const char[] szName, bool bDontBroadcast) { if (!pending && soccer) { Terminar(); } } public IsValidClient( client ) { if ( !( 1 <= client <= MaxClients ) || !IsClientInGame(client) ) return false; return true; } stock void SetCvar(char cvarName[64], int value) { Handle IntCvar = FindConVar(cvarName); if (IntCvar == null) return; int flags = GetConVarFlags(IntCvar); flags &= ~FCVAR_NOTIFY; SetConVarFlags(IntCvar, flags); SetConVarInt(IntCvar, value); flags |= FCVAR_NOTIFY; SetConVarFlags(IntCvar, flags); } stock void SetCvarString(char cvarName[64], char[] value) { Handle cvar = FindConVar(cvarName); SetConVarString(cvar, value, true); } public Action:OnWeaponCanUse(client, weapon) { if (soccer && client == thanos) { // block switching to weapon other than knife decl String:sClassname[32]; GetEdictClassname(weapon, sClassname, sizeof(sClassname)); if (StrContains(sClassname, "knife") == -1 && StrContains(sClassname, "bayonet") == -1 && StrContains(sClassname, "hegrenade") == -1) return Plugin_Handled; } return Plugin_Continue; } public OnClientPutInServer(client) { SDKHook(client, SDKHook_WeaponCanUse, OnWeaponCanUse); SDKHook(client, SDKHook_OnTakeDamage, OnTakeDamage); } public Action:OnTakeDamage(victim, &attacker, &inflictor, &Float:damage, &damagetype, &weapon, Float:damageForce[3], Float:damagePosition[3]){ if(!soccer)return Plugin_Continue; if(attacker == thanos && victim != thanos){ if (!IsValidEntity(weapon)) return Plugin_Continue; new String:weaponclassname[20]; GetEntityClassname(weapon, weaponclassname, sizeof(weaponclassname)); if (StrContains(weaponclassname, "knife") > -1 || StrContains(weaponclassname, "bayonet") > -1) { damage *= 60.0; return Plugin_Changed; } return Plugin_Continue; } else{ return Plugin_Continue; } } stock GetRandomPlayer() { new clients[MaxClients+1], clientCount; for (new i = 1; i <= MaxClients; i++) if (IsClientInGame(i) && GetClientTeam(i) > 1) clients[clientCount++] = i; return (clientCount == 0) ? -1 : clients[GetRandomInt(0, clientCount-1)]; } public OnEntityCreated(iEntity, const String:classname[]) { if (!soccer)return; if (StrEqual(classname, "hegrenade_projectile", false)) { HookSingleEntityOutput(iEntity, "OnUser2", InitMissile, true); new String:OutputString[50] = "OnUser1 !self:FireUser2::0.0:1"; SetVariantString(OutputString); AcceptEntityInput(iEntity, "AddOutput"); AcceptEntityInput(iEntity, "FireUser1"); } } public Action Timer_ThanosGranada(Handle timer) { if (!thanos || !IsClientInGame(thanos))return; GivePlayerItem(thanos, "weapon_hegrenade"); } public InitMissile(const String:output[], caller, activator, Float:delay) { new NadeOwner = GetEntPropEnt(caller, Prop_Send, "m_hThrower"); // assume other plugins don't set this on any projectiles they create, this avoids conflicts. if (NadeOwner == -1 || thanos != NadeOwner) { return; } //ignore the projectile if this team can't use missiles. //new NadeTeam = GetEntProp(caller, Prop_Send, "m_iTeamNum"); // stop the projectile thinking so it doesn't detonate. SetEntProp(caller, Prop_Data, "m_nNextThinkTick", -1); SetEntityMoveType(caller, MOVETYPE_FLY); SetEntityModel(caller, "models/weapons/w_missile_closed.mdl"); // make it spin correctly. SetEntPropVector(caller, Prop_Data, "m_vecAngVelocity", SpinVel); // stop it bouncing when it hits something SetEntPropFloat(caller, Prop_Send, "m_flElasticity", 0.0); SetEntPropVector(caller, Prop_Send, "m_vecMins", MinNadeHull); SetEntPropVector(caller, Prop_Send, "m_vecMaxs", MaxNadeHull); new SmokeIndex = CreateEntityByName("env_rockettrail"); if (SmokeIndex != -1) { SetEntPropFloat(SmokeIndex, Prop_Send, "m_Opacity", 0.5); SetEntPropFloat(SmokeIndex, Prop_Send, "m_SpawnRate", 100.0); SetEntPropFloat(SmokeIndex, Prop_Send, "m_ParticleLifetime", 0.5); SetEntPropFloat(SmokeIndex, Prop_Send, "m_StartSize", 5.0); SetEntPropFloat(SmokeIndex, Prop_Send, "m_EndSize", 30.0); SetEntPropFloat(SmokeIndex, Prop_Send, "m_SpawnRadius", 0.0); SetEntPropFloat(SmokeIndex, Prop_Send, "m_MinSpeed", 0.0); SetEntPropFloat(SmokeIndex, Prop_Send, "m_MaxSpeed", 10.0); SetEntPropFloat(SmokeIndex, Prop_Send, "m_flFlareScale", 1.0); DispatchSpawn(SmokeIndex); ActivateEntity(SmokeIndex); new String:NadeName[20]; Format(NadeName, sizeof(NadeName), "Nade_%i", caller); DispatchKeyValue(caller, "targetname", NadeName); SetVariantString(NadeName); AcceptEntityInput(SmokeIndex, "SetParent"); TeleportEntity(SmokeIndex, SmokeOrigin, SmokeAngle, NULL_VECTOR); } // make the missile go towards the coordinates the player is looking at. new Float:NadePos[3]; GetEntPropVector(caller, Prop_Send, "m_vecOrigin", NadePos); new Float:OwnerAng[3]; GetClientEyeAngles(NadeOwner, OwnerAng); new Float:OwnerPos[3]; GetClientEyePosition(NadeOwner, OwnerPos); TR_TraceRayFilter(OwnerPos, OwnerAng, MASK_SOLID, RayType_Infinite, DontHitOwnerOrNade, caller); new Float:InitialPos[3]; TR_GetEndPosition(InitialPos); new Float:InitialVec[3]; MakeVectorFromPoints(NadePos, InitialPos, InitialVec); NormalizeVector(InitialVec, InitialVec); ScaleVector(InitialVec, NadeSpeed); new Float:InitialAng[3]; GetVectorAngles(InitialVec, InitialAng); TeleportEntity(caller, NULL_VECTOR, InitialAng, InitialVec); EmitSoundToAll("music/franug_rocket1.mp3", caller, 1, 90); HookSingleEntityOutput(caller, "OnUser2", MissileThink); new String:OutputString[50] = "OnUser1 !self:FireUser2::0.1:-1"; SetVariantString(OutputString); AcceptEntityInput(caller, "AddOutput"); AcceptEntityInput(caller, "FireUser1"); SDKHook(caller, SDKHook_StartTouchPost, OnStartTouchPost); CreateTimer(3.0, Timer_ThanosGranada); } public MissileThink(const String:output[], caller, activator, Float:delay) { // detonate any missiles that stopped for any reason but didn't detonate. decl Float:CheckVec[3]; GetEntPropVector(caller, Prop_Send, "m_vecVelocity", CheckVec); if (((CheckVec[0] == 0.0) && (CheckVec[1] == 0.0) && (CheckVec[2] == 0.0))) { StopSound(caller, 1, "music/franug_rocket1.mp3"); CreateExplosion(caller); return; } //decl Float:NadePos[3]; //GetEntPropVector(caller, Prop_Send, "m_vecOrigin", NadePos); //new client = GetEntPropEnt(data, Prop_Send, "m_hThrower"); /* new dado = GetTraceHullEntityIndex(NadePos, caller); if(IsClientIndex(dado) && ZR_IsClientZombie(dado)) { StopSound(caller, 1, "music/franug_rocket1.mp3"); CreateExplosion(caller); return; } */ AcceptEntityInput(caller, "FireUser1"); } /* GetTraceHullEntityIndex(Float:pos[3], xindex) { TR_TraceHullFilter(pos, pos, g_fMinS, g_fMaxS, MASK_SHOT, THFilter, xindex); return TR_GetEntityIndex(); } public bool:THFilter(entity, contentsMask, any:data) { return IsClientIndex(entity) && (entity != data); } bool:IsClientIndex(index) { return (index > 0) && (index <= MaxClients); }*/ public bool:DontHitOwnerOrNade(entity, contentsMask, any:data) { new NadeOwner = GetEntPropEnt(data, Prop_Send, "m_hThrower"); return ((entity != data) && (entity != NadeOwner)); } public OnStartTouchPost(entity, other) { // detonate if the missile hits something solid. if ((GetEntProp(other, Prop_Data, "m_nSolidType") != SOLID_NONE) && (!(GetEntProp(other, Prop_Data, "m_usSolidFlags") & FSOLID_NOT_SOLID))) { StopSound(entity, 1, "music/franug_rocket1.mp3"); CreateExplosion(entity); } } CreateExplosion(entity) { UnhookSingleEntityOutput(entity, "OnUser2", MissileThink); new Float:MissilePos[3]; GetEntPropVector(entity, Prop_Send, "m_vecOrigin", MissilePos); new MissileOwner = GetEntPropEnt(entity, Prop_Send, "m_hThrower"); new MissileOwnerTeam = GetEntProp(entity, Prop_Send, "m_iTeamNum"); AcceptEntityInput(entity, "Kill"); new ExplosionIndex = CreateEntityByName("env_explosion"); if (ExplosionIndex != -1) { DispatchKeyValue(ExplosionIndex,"classname","hegrenade_projectile"); SetEntProp(ExplosionIndex, Prop_Data, "m_spawnflags", 6146); SetEntProp(ExplosionIndex, Prop_Data, "m_iMagnitude", NadeDamage); SetEntProp(ExplosionIndex, Prop_Data, "m_iRadiusOverride", NadeRadius); DispatchSpawn(ExplosionIndex); ActivateEntity(ExplosionIndex); TeleportEntity(ExplosionIndex, MissilePos, NULL_VECTOR, NULL_VECTOR); SetEntPropEnt(ExplosionIndex, Prop_Send, "m_hOwnerEntity", MissileOwner); SetEntProp(ExplosionIndex, Prop_Send, "m_iTeamNum", MissileOwnerTeam); EmitSoundToAll("weapons/hegrenade/explode5.wav", ExplosionIndex, 1, 90); AcceptEntityInput(ExplosionIndex, "Explode"); DispatchKeyValue(ExplosionIndex,"classname","env_explosion"); AcceptEntityInput(ExplosionIndex, "Kill"); } /* new Float:SmokeOrigin2[3]; GetEntPropVector(entity, Prop_Send, "m_vecOrigin", SmokeOrigin2); new client = GetEntPropEnt(entity, Prop_Send, "m_hThrower"); new userid = GetClientUserId(client); new Handle:event = CreateEvent("hegrenade_detonate"); SetEventInt(event, "userid", userid); SetEventFloat(event, "x", SmokeOrigin2[0]); SetEventFloat(event, "y", SmokeOrigin2[1]); SetEventFloat(event, "z", SmokeOrigin2[2]); FireEvent(event); */ } #define HEIGHT 2.0 #define LENGTH 1.0 public Action:Event_OnPlayerJumpPre(Handle:event, const String:name[], bool:dontBroadcast) { if (!soccer)return; new client = GetClientOfUserId(GetEventInt(event, "userid")); if (client != thanos)return; SetEntityGravity(thanos, 0.3); } public Action:Event_OnPlayerJump(Handle:event, const String:name[], bool:dontBroadcast) { if (!soccer)return; new client = GetClientOfUserId(GetEventInt(event, "userid")); if (client != thanos)return; CreateTimer(0.0, EventPlayerJumpPost, client); } public Action:EventPlayerJumpPost(Handle:timer, any:client) { // If client isn't in-game, then stop. if (!IsClientInGame(client)) { return; } // Forward event to modules. JumpBoostOnClientJumpPost(client); } /** * Client is jumping. * * @param client The client index. */ JumpBoostOnClientJumpPost(client) { // Get class jump multipliers. new Float:distancemultiplier = LENGTH; new Float:heightmultiplier = HEIGHT; // If both are set to 1.0, then stop here to save some work. if (distancemultiplier == 1.0 && heightmultiplier == 1.0) { return; } new Float:vecVelocity[3]; // Get client's current velocity. ToolsClientVelocity(client, vecVelocity, false); // Only apply horizontal multiplier if it's not a bhop. if (!JumpBoostIsBHop(vecVelocity)) { // Apply horizontal multipliers to jump vector. vecVelocity[0] *= distancemultiplier; vecVelocity[1] *= distancemultiplier; } // Apply height multiplier to jump vector. vecVelocity[2] *= heightmultiplier; // Set new velocity. ToolsClientVelocity(client, vecVelocity, true, false); } /** * This function detects excessive bunnyhopping. * Note: This ONLY catches bunnyhopping that is worse than CS:S already allows. * * @param vecVelocity The velocity of the client jumping. * @return True if the client is bunnyhopping, false if not. */ stock bool:JumpBoostIsBHop(const Float:vecVelocity[]) { // Calculate the magnitude of jump on the xy plane. new Float:magnitude = SquareRoot(Pow(vecVelocity[0], 2.0) + Pow(vecVelocity[1], 2.0)); // Return true if the magnitude exceeds the max. new Float:bunnyhopmax = 300.0; return (magnitude > bunnyhopmax); } stock ToolsClientVelocity(client, Float:vecVelocity[3], bool:apply = true, bool:stack = true) { // If retrieve if true, then get client's velocity. if (!apply) { // x = vector component. for (new x = 0; x < 3; x++) { vecVelocity[x] = GetEntDataFloat(client, g_iToolsVelocity + (x*4)); } // Stop here. return; } // If stack is true, then add client's velocity. if (stack) { // Get client's velocity. new Float:vecClientVelocity[3]; // x = vector component. for (new x = 0; x < 3; x++) { vecClientVelocity[x] = GetEntDataFloat(client, g_iToolsVelocity + (x*4)); } AddVectors(vecClientVelocity, vecVelocity, vecVelocity); } // Apply velocity on client. TeleportEntity(client, NULL_VECTOR, NULL_VECTOR, vecVelocity); } stock bool HasPermission(int iClient, char[] flagString) { if (StrEqual(flagString, "")) { return true; } AdminId admin = GetUserAdmin(iClient); if (admin != INVALID_ADMIN_ID) { int count, found, flags = ReadFlagString(flagString); for (int i = 0; i <= 20; i++) { if (flags & (1<<i)) { count++; if (GetAdminFlag(admin, view_as<AdminFlag>(i))) { found++; } } } if (count == found) { return true; } } return false; }
